Received my new card today.

While calling up to activate the card, i took the opportunity to ask about Balance Transfer. The CS was kind and polite enough to explain it to me.

So, it's confirmed that, when you perform BT,
- Any retail transaction done will incur 18% per annum interest 'IMMEDIATELY'! So, wise thing to do is to keep the card in the drawer until you fully settled the outstanding.
- The whole outstanding amount will appear on the card
- If you opt for 0% interest for X month, you can choose to pay the minimum 5% of your outstanding amount for month 1, until X-1.  At month X, you must pay off the total outstanding, or 18% interest will be imposed on the outstanding amount.

For the last bit, it's good and bad in a way. If you are disciplined enough, you can try out the 5% repayment + final full settlement. Otherwise, please set a repayment schedule for yourself.

Good thing is, at month X, you can do another BT to pay off HSBC to continue the repayment on another financial institution. But please please please be diligent or else you will end up in the trap you set for your own.
